New Zealand needs to get ahead of a wall of subsidised wood products heading this way as overseas players shore up their processing industries in response to the covid-19 pandemic, local manufacturers say.An export log ban announced by Russia a month ago is the latest in a string of measures that are going to drive “major shifts” in the direction of wood product flows out of China and Europe, said Jon Tanner, chief executive of the Wood Processors and Manufacturers Association.The Russian ban, proposed from January 2022, will reduce...
